I have a 28 gallon tank in my office, lit by 2x55w pc's. I'd love to try a small clam in the tank (current occupants: ocellaris clown, juvenile hippo tang, juvenile snowflake eel, a few emerald crabs, 2 cukes, and 3 serpent stars along with several snails and hermits). Currently I'm just growing some mushrooms and star polyps. Is there a species of clam that will do well under this lighting? Thanks for all your advice.
 
I would strongly urge you to not put a clam into that environment. That is, of course, unless you wanted to feed the other animals.

You'll see numerous posts on the board here about bad things that happen when clams are placed into environments with crabs / hermits. I just hope the eel wouldn't take a liking to your clam as well :eek2:

If it was clear then you could get away with a T. Derasa as they are fairly tolerant.
